Составители:
122
Константа – именованный элемент, сохраняющий постоянное
значение в течение выполнения программ.
Константа может быть задана как строковый или числовой литерал
(константа в явном представлении), другая константа или любая комби-
нация констант и арифметических и логических операторов, за исключе-
нием операторов Is и возведения в степень. В каждом главном приложе-
нии можно определить собственный набор констант. Пользователь имеет
возможность определить дополнительные константы
с помощью инст-
рукции Const. Константы могут использоваться в любых местах про-
граммы вместо реальных значений.
Пример
.
10 – константа (любое число является константой);
"ad" – константа (любое выражение в кавычках является константой).
Процедура Sub представляет собой последовательность инструкций
языка Visual Basic, ограниченных инструкциями Sub и End Sub, которая
выполняет действия, но не возвращает значение. Процедура Sub может
получать аргументы, как, например, константы, переменные, или выра-
жения, передаваемые ей вызывающей процедурой. Если процедура Sub
не
имеет аргументов, инструкция Sub должна содержать пустые скобки.
У нас имеется следующий текст:
Private Sub CommandButton1_Click();
End Sub.
В нашем случае перед оператором Sub стоит инструкция Private.
Так же как и для переменных, эта инструкция означает, что данная про-
цедура будет доступная в пределах одного модуля – в нашем случае это
"Лист 1 (Сессия)". После оператора
Sub идет имя процедуры. Данное имя
Excel дает автоматически, так как основной процедурой на объект класса
«Кнопка» является обработка события "нажатие мышью на кнопку"
(«Click»). Имя процедуры состоит из имени объекта – CommandButton1 и
названия события – «Click». Процедура не получает параметров, поэтому
после имени процедуры идут пустые скобки – (). Между этими двумя
строчками
необходимо написать текст программы, которая вызовет на
экран окно со статистическими данными. Этот код заключается в одной
строчке: UserForm1.Show
Инструкция Show является методом, который показывает на экран объ-
ект класса UserForm. Объекта пока не существует, поэтому создадим его.
Для создания объекта класса UserForm нажмите на панели инстру-
ментов «Стандарт» соответствующую кнопку, либо
через меню «Встав-
ка» командой «UserForm». Необходимо изменить заголовок этой формы
(свойство Caption) на фразу "Статистика по студентам". Размеры самого
окна подправляются в процессе создания других объектов. Свойство
Константа – именованный элемент, сохраняющий постоянное
значение в течение выполнения программ.
Константа может быть задана как строковый или числовой литерал
(константа в явном представлении), другая константа или любая комби-
нация констант и арифметических и логических операторов, за исключе-
нием операторов Is и возведения в степень. В каждом главном приложе-
нии можно определить собственный набор констант. Пользователь имеет
возможность определить дополнительные константы с помощью инст-
рукции Const. Константы могут использоваться в любых местах про-
граммы вместо реальных значений.
Пример.
10 – константа (любое число является константой);
"ad" – константа (любое выражение в кавычках является константой).
Процедура Sub представляет собой последовательность инструкций
языка Visual Basic, ограниченных инструкциями Sub и End Sub, которая
выполняет действия, но не возвращает значение. Процедура Sub может
получать аргументы, как, например, константы, переменные, или выра-
жения, передаваемые ей вызывающей процедурой. Если процедура Sub
не имеет аргументов, инструкция Sub должна содержать пустые скобки.
У нас имеется следующий текст:
Private Sub CommandButton1_Click();
End Sub.
В нашем случае перед оператором Sub стоит инструкция Private.
Так же как и для переменных, эта инструкция означает, что данная про-
цедура будет доступная в пределах одного модуля – в нашем случае это
"Лист 1 (Сессия)". После оператора Sub идет имя процедуры. Данное имя
Excel дает автоматически, так как основной процедурой на объект класса
«Кнопка» является обработка события "нажатие мышью на кнопку"
(«Click»). Имя процедуры состоит из имени объекта – CommandButton1 и
названия события – «Click». Процедура не получает параметров, поэтому
после имени процедуры идут пустые скобки – (). Между этими двумя
строчками необходимо написать текст программы, которая вызовет на
экран окно со статистическими данными. Этот код заключается в одной
строчке: UserForm1.Show
Инструкция Show является методом, который показывает на экран объ-
ект класса UserForm. Объекта пока не существует, поэтому создадим его.
Для создания объекта класса UserForm нажмите на панели инстру-
ментов «Стандарт» соответствующую кнопку, либо через меню «Встав-
ка» командой «UserForm». Необходимо изменить заголовок этой формы
(свойство Caption) на фразу "Статистика по студентам". Размеры самого
окна подправляются в процессе создания других объектов. Свойство
122
Страницы
- « первая
- ‹ предыдущая
- …
- 118
- 119
- 120
- 121
- 122
- …
- следующая ›
- последняя »
